Census Registration Districts do not keep to County Boundaries,
hence the following HAMPSHIRE place can be found on th
Dorset 1861 Census CD discs.

1881 CENSUS TRANSCRIPT & INDEX
1881 Census Index  for entire County of Hampshire in 7 sets of fiche

(Surname Index, Birth Place Index, Census Place Index, As Enumerated, Misc. Notes, Ships, Institutions). 
Also on CD (1881 British Census and Index).
